English: Two preserved specimens from perciform fish genus Crenicichla. The species seen here are C. urosema (top), measuring 53.5 mm SL, and C. virgatula (bottom), the holotype, measuring 66.2 mm SL. This photograph was taken to demonstrate the difference in the markings on the caudal peduncle (tail-fin joint) between the two species.
